[QUOTE="carbjunky, post: 121011, member: 24148"] Ruth Stop beating yourself up! It may be that you need to try different approaches to stabilising your blood sugars - depending on how much insulin you are still making yourself and how insulin resistant you are, you may need different treatments. Some people manage stable BS's with diet alone, others with diet and metformin, others need diet and metformin and other drugs too.
